Core Feng Shui Rules to Follow

1. Declutter and Clean Regularly

Clutter blocks energy flow and creates stagnation. One of the most important rules of feng shui is to keep your home tidy and organized. Sort your belongings into keep, donate, or discard piles. Use smart storage solutions to maintain a clutter-free environment. This simple step alone can dramatically improve the energy in your home.

2. Commanding Position for Key Furniture

The feng shui rules emphasize placing important pieces like your bed, desk, or stove in the commanding position. This means positioning them so you can see the door without being directly in line with it. This arrangement fosters a sense of control and security, which is essential for peace of mind.

3. Balance the Five Elements

Feng Shui is based on the harmony of five elements: wood, fire, earth, metal, and water. Incorporate these through colors, shapes, and materials:

  • Wood: green plants, wooden furniture
  • Fire: candles, red or orange accents
  • Earth: earthy tones, ceramics
  • Metal: metallic decor, white or gray colors
  • Water: fountains, blue or black hues

Balancing these elements supports different areas of your life, from health to wealth.

4. Keep Main Door Clear and Inviting

The main entrance is the gateway for energy into your home. Follow simple feng shui rules by keeping this area clean, well-lit, and free of obstacles. Avoid placing shoes, umbrellas, or clutter near the door. A welcoming entry invites positive chi to flow effortlessly inside.

5. Optimize Natural Light and Airflow

Good ventilation and natural light are vital basic feng shui house rules. Open curtains during the day, keep windows clean, and avoid heavy drapes that block sunlight. Fresh air and light energize your space and uplift your mood.

6. Use Mirrors Wisely

Mirrors can expand space and reflect energy, but feng shui rules caution against placing them directly opposite doors or beds, as this can push energy away or cause restlessness. Position mirrors to enhance light and create a sense of openness without disrupting the flow.

7. Avoid Sharp Corners Pointing at You

Sharp corners or “poison arrows” are believed to create negative energy. Arrange furniture and decor to soften harsh angles or use plants and fabric to diffuse sharp lines. This aligns with rules for feng shui that promote calm and comfort.

Room-Specific Feng Shui Rules

  • Living Room: Arrange seating to face each other and avoid backs to the door. Keep the space open and welcoming.
  • Bedroom: Avoid storing items under the bed and keep electronics to a minimum for restful energy.
  • Kitchen: Maintain cleanliness and place the stove away from the sink to balance fire and water elements.
  • Bathroom: Keep doors and toilet lids closed to prevent energy drain.
